Precise new form of brain surgery requires no incisions, scalpels

WebAug 17, 2024 · The new option – called MR-guided focused ultrasound – uses sound wave energy to treat brain tissue that is the source of the tremor. No surgical incision or anesthesia is necessary, and many patients experience immediate and significant reduction in hand tremors, which can make daily activities challenging.
